Stats Helper is an way to do basic statistics in Excel. It is extremely simple to use. Functionality includes:
- For understanding distributions: (v 0.8)
Histograms and Normality (Quantile-Quantile) plots- Descriptive Statistics
- For understanding proportions: (new to version 1.0)
- Work with actual pass/fail data, or summarized data
- Confidence intervals for mean, basic descriptive statistics
- Probable ranges, depicted graphically and numerically
- For comparing sample distributions:
- Graphing distributions and confidence intervals
- Hypothesis testing
- Confidence intervals for means and for the difference between 2 means.
- Analysis of Variation (ANOVA)
- For comparing distributions of proportions:
- Graphs of distributions and confidence intervals
- Hypothesis testing
Confidence intervals for means and for the difference between 2 means.
- Binomial probabilities
- Linear Regression
- Regression plots
- expression calculation
- Calculate predictions
- Control Charting
- Create Individuals charts, Xbar charts, and P charts
- Automatic calculation and display
Process Capability-
- Calculations of common capability indices (Cp, Cpk, Pp, Ppk)
- Graphic representation of capability (new to version 1.0)
- Confidence interval for Cpk
- Calculator to translate Cpk, DPMO, Yields, and Z into other measurements
- Power and Sample Size
Unlike professional statistical software packages that cost over $1000, Stats Helper gives you basic functionality simply, and at a fraction of the cost.
